HR Administrator
1 month ago
Join a highly collaborative People & Culture team supporting one of Australia's key Defence transitions.
This fast-paced HR Coordinator role is perfect for someone who thrives in a busy environment, loves handling detail, and enjoys being the go-to person for smooth onboarding and HR administration
THE IMPORTANT BITS
- Monday - Friday, 9AM - 5PM
- $35PH + Super, Weekly Pay
- ASAP Start
THE ROLE
- Coordinate pre-employment checks including police checks and medicals
- Review medical outcomes and liaise with SHEQ as needed
- Track candidate progress and update SuccessFactors
- Draft Letters of Offer and consultation letters
- Prepare onboarding documents and collaborate closely with Payroll & OM teams
- Provide high-quality HR and administrative support to ensure all new starters are onboarded smoothly into SAP
- Assist the team with time-critical tasks throughout the DBS → BST transition
THE PERSON
- HR degree or equivalent professional experience
- Strong Microsoft Office skills
- Experience in onboarding, drafting letters, booking medicals, and supporting a busy HR or operational team
- SAP and/or SuccessFactors experience
Why You'll Love This Role
- Be part of a major Defence contract mobilisation
- Work with supportive leaders across Projects, P&C, Payroll and Operations
- Make a real impact ensuring new starters are onboarded accurately and on time
- Potential for contract extension in the new year
- Hybrid potential after the initial training period
